With global sales on the dip, in Europe the Volkswagen group continues to lead the pack among some of the most exclusive auto makers in the world. European brands have long been known for their superb engineering at a price but the German automaker has succeeded in an area where others have miserably failed, in diversifying their products.
From cars that cater to teens and yuppies to more mature models, they have something for everybody which makes them the best at what they do. They have been affected by the slump of markets globally yet they remain a figure in the auto industry as car markets continue to rise and slump. Volkswagen traces its lineage way back to a time when they were indistinguishable from Porsche with some of their earlier models having interchangeable parts. As they continue their lead in the global auto market, they lead with innovation and that ever present European flair to continue leading into the future.
